2009 Suzuki XL7 vs. 2011 Mercedes-Benz R
To start off, 2011 Mercedes-Benz R is newer by 2 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2009 Suzuki XL7.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2009 Suzuki XL7 would be higher. At 3,564 cc (6 cylinders), 2009 Suzuki XL7 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2009 Suzuki XL7 (252 HP @ 6400 RPM) has 42 more horse power than 2011 Mercedes-Benz R. (210 HP @ 3400 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2009 Suzuki XL7 should accelerate faster than 2011 Mercedes-Benz R.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2011 Mercedes-Benz R weights approximately 530 kg more than 2009 Suzuki XL7.
With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2011 Mercedes-Benz R (542 Nm @ 1600 RPM) has 212 more torque (in Nm) than 2009 Suzuki XL7. (330 Nm @ 2300 RPM). This means 2011 Mercedes-Benz R will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2009 Suzuki XL7.
